Boyer, Sundar Srinivasan","submitted_at":"2015-07-24T20:01:32Z","abstract_excerpt":"We have identified a new class of Asymptotic Giant Branch (AGB) stars in the Small and Large Magellanic Clouds (SMC/LMC) using optical to infrared photometry, light curves, and optical spectroscopy. The strong dust production and long-period pulsations of these stars indicate that they are at the very end of their AGB evolution.
